Beschreibung:

Six iris prints, printed later (selected by Bruno Barbey , each signed in pencil with Magnum Magnum Book Print stamps verso, each approximately 23.4 x 35.5cm (9 1/4 x 14in) or the reverse The other print titles in this lot: Young Boy Selling Flowers, Sophot, Poland, 1956; The Black Madonna of Czestochowa, Poland, 1956; Fairground, Nova Huta, Poland, 1956; A Hebrew School, Cracow, Poland, 1956; Young Women Working on the Railway at the Former Hohenzollern Colliery, Bytom, Poland, 1956 Literature: Brigitte Lardinois (ed), Magnum Magnum, 2007, pp.322-331 "I take humanity seriously, in all its aspirations and desires, as in everything that can follow, whether in religion or spirituality, art or politics. This was, and still is today, the starting point for all my photography subjects...." (Erich Lessing
